Understanding Licensing and Safety
Before you start playing, it’s essential to ensure that the online casino is licensed and regulated. This not only confirms the legitimacy of the casino but also provides a safety net for players. Here’s what to look for:
- Regulatory Authorities: Check if the casino is licensed by recognized authorities like the UK Gambling Commission or the Malta Gaming Authority. These organizations enforce strict regulations to protect players.
- SSL Encryption: Ensure the casino uses SSL encryption to protect your personal and financial data. This technology scrambles your information, making it unreadable to potential hackers.
- Fair Play Certifications: Look for casinos that have been audited by independent organizations like eCOGRA. These certifications ensure that the games are fair and the odds are transparent.
Evaluating the Odds and RTP
One of the most critical aspects of playing at online casinos is understanding the return to player (RTP) percentage. The RTP indicates how much of the wagered money is returned to players over time. Here’s how it works:
- Typical RTP Values: Most online slots have an RTP ranging from 92% to 98%. This means, for every $100 wagered, you can expect to get back $92 to $98 in the long run.
- House Edge: The house edge is the casino’s advantage over players. For example, a slot with an RTP of 95% has a house edge of 5%, meaning the casino retains 5% of the total bets made.
- Game Variability: Different games have distinct RTP values. For instance, table games like blackjack may offer higher RTPs (up to 99%) compared to slots.
Wagering Requirements: The Fine Print
Bonuses are an attractive feature of online casinos, but they often come with wagering requirements that can be tricky. Here’s a breakdown:
| Bonus Type | Typical Wagering Requirement | Time Limit |
|---|---|---|
| Welcome Bonus | 35x | 30 days |
| No Deposit Bonus | 50x | 14 days |
| Free Spins | 20x | 7 days |
Understanding wagering requirements is vital because:
- Complexity: A 35x requirement on a $100 bonus means you must wager $3,500 before cashing out.
- Game Contributions: Not all games contribute equally to wagering requirements. For instance, slots may contribute 100%, while table games may contribute only 10%.
Potential Pitfalls to Avoid
While online casinos offer exciting opportunities, several pitfalls can hinder your experience. Stay vigilant about the following:
- Lack of Transparency: Avoid casinos that do not clearly display their licensing information or game odds.
- Overly Generous Bonuses: Be cautious of offers that seem too good to be true; these may come with stringent terms.
- Unregulated Sites: Playing on unlicensed sites can lead to financial losses and a lack of recourse.
